Reference documentation and code samples for the Distributed Cloud Edge Container V1 API class Google::Cloud::EdgeContainer::V1::VpnConnection.
A VPN connection .
Inherits
- Object
Extended By
- Google::Protobuf::MessageExts::ClassMethods
Includes
- Google::Protobuf::MessageExts
Methods
#bgp_routing_mode
def bgp_routing_mode() -> ::Google::Cloud::EdgeContainer::V1::VpnConnection::BgpRoutingMode Returns
- (::Google::Cloud::EdgeContainer::V1::VpnConnection::BgpRoutingMode) — Dynamic routing mode of the VPC network,
regionalorglobal.
#bgp_routing_mode=
def bgp_routing_mode=(value) -> ::Google::Cloud::EdgeContainer::V1::VpnConnection::BgpRoutingMode Parameter
- value (::Google::Cloud::EdgeContainer::V1::VpnConnection::BgpRoutingMode) — Dynamic routing mode of the VPC network,
regionalorglobal.
Returns
- (::Google::Cloud::EdgeContainer::V1::VpnConnection::BgpRoutingMode) — Dynamic routing mode of the VPC network,
regionalorglobal.
#cluster
def cluster() -> ::String Returns
- (::String) — The canonical Cluster name to connect to. It is in the form of projects/{project}/locations/{location}/clusters/{cluster}.
#cluster=
def cluster=(value) -> ::String Parameter
- value (::String) — The canonical Cluster name to connect to. It is in the form of projects/{project}/locations/{location}/clusters/{cluster}.
Returns
- (::String) — The canonical Cluster name to connect to. It is in the form of projects/{project}/locations/{location}/clusters/{cluster}.
#create_time
def create_time() -> ::Google::Protobuf::Timestamp Returns
- (::Google::Protobuf::Timestamp) — Output only. The time when the VPN connection was created.
#details
def details() -> ::Google::Cloud::EdgeContainer::V1::VpnConnection::Details Returns
- (::Google::Cloud::EdgeContainer::V1::VpnConnection::Details) — Output only. The created connection details.
#enable_high_availability
def enable_high_availability() -> ::Boolean Returns
- (::Boolean) — Whether this VPN connection has HA enabled on cluster side. If enabled, when creating VPN connection we will attempt to use 2 ANG floating IPs.
#enable_high_availability=
def enable_high_availability=(value) -> ::Boolean Parameter
- value (::Boolean) — Whether this VPN connection has HA enabled on cluster side. If enabled, when creating VPN connection we will attempt to use 2 ANG floating IPs.
Returns
- (::Boolean) — Whether this VPN connection has HA enabled on cluster side. If enabled, when creating VPN connection we will attempt to use 2 ANG floating IPs.
#labels
def labels() -> ::Google::Protobuf::Map{::String => ::String} Returns
- (::Google::Protobuf::Map{::String => ::String}) — Labels associated with this resource.
#labels=
def labels=(value) -> ::Google::Protobuf::Map{::String => ::String} Parameter
- value (::Google::Protobuf::Map{::String => ::String}) — Labels associated with this resource.
Returns
- (::Google::Protobuf::Map{::String => ::String}) — Labels associated with this resource.
#name
def name() -> ::String Returns
- (::String) — Required. The resource name of VPN connection
#name=
def name=(value) -> ::String Parameter
- value (::String) — Required. The resource name of VPN connection
Returns
- (::String) — Required. The resource name of VPN connection
#nat_gateway_ip
def nat_gateway_ip() -> ::String Returns
- (::String) — NAT gateway IP, or WAN IP address. If a customer has multiple NAT IPs, the customer needs to configure NAT such that only one external IP maps to the GMEC Anthos cluster. This is empty if NAT is not used.
#nat_gateway_ip=
def nat_gateway_ip=(value) -> ::String Parameter
- value (::String) — NAT gateway IP, or WAN IP address. If a customer has multiple NAT IPs, the customer needs to configure NAT such that only one external IP maps to the GMEC Anthos cluster. This is empty if NAT is not used.
Returns
- (::String) — NAT gateway IP, or WAN IP address. If a customer has multiple NAT IPs, the customer needs to configure NAT such that only one external IP maps to the GMEC Anthos cluster. This is empty if NAT is not used.
#router
def router() -> ::String Returns
- (::String) — Optional. The VPN connection Cloud Router name.
#router=
def router=(value) -> ::String Parameter
- value (::String) — Optional. The VPN connection Cloud Router name.
Returns
- (::String) — Optional. The VPN connection Cloud Router name.
#update_time
def update_time() -> ::Google::Protobuf::Timestamp Returns
- (::Google::Protobuf::Timestamp) — Output only. The time when the VPN connection was last updated.
#vpc
def vpc() -> ::String Returns
- (::String) — The network ID of VPC to connect to.
#vpc=
def vpc=(value) -> ::String Parameter
- value (::String) — The network ID of VPC to connect to.
Returns
- (::String) — The network ID of VPC to connect to.
#vpc_project
def vpc_project() -> ::Google::Cloud::EdgeContainer::V1::VpnConnection::VpcProject Returns
- (::Google::Cloud::EdgeContainer::V1::VpnConnection::VpcProject) — Optional. Project detail of the VPC network. Required if VPC is in a different project than the cluster project.
#vpc_project=
def vpc_project=(value) -> ::Google::Cloud::EdgeContainer::V1::VpnConnection::VpcProject Parameter
- value (::Google::Cloud::EdgeContainer::V1::VpnConnection::VpcProject) — Optional. Project detail of the VPC network. Required if VPC is in a different project than the cluster project.
Returns
- (::Google::Cloud::EdgeContainer::V1::VpnConnection::VpcProject) — Optional. Project detail of the VPC network. Required if VPC is in a different project than the cluster project.
